What to Look For in AI Article Generation Tools
First sentence: Strong AI article generation tools must deliver output that ranks, converts readers, and integrates with existing workflows.
Teams need clarity on maximum article length supported before choosing any platform. This factor determines whether the system handles short posts or produces full long form pieces without breaking content into smaller chunks. Review the stated limits on each plan to avoid hitting barriers mid project.
Number of languages offered shapes audience reach. A platform that supports many languages lets content teams publish in multiple markets without switching tools or hiring translators. Check the accuracy level per language before committing to large scale projects.
Native SERP and competitor analysis features reduce manual research time. Tools that pull current search data and review rival pages help writers build outlines that target ranking opportunities. This built in capability speeds up planning and improves topical coverage.
Credit rollover policy protects budget across billing cycles. Platforms that carry unused credits forward give teams flexibility during slow periods or high demand months. Review the exact rollover rules to understand potential savings over time.
Number of native integrations affects daily workflow efficiency. Systems that connect directly to popular content management platforms, analytics tools, and marketing stacks reduce copy paste steps and manual exports. Count the listed connections before selecting a final option.
Human editing workflow options determine how much post generation work remains. Some platforms offer side by side editing modes, suggestion highlights, and version history that speed up the review process. Evaluate these features if your team requires frequent revisions or brand voice adjustments.
Weekly feature update cadence shows how quickly a platform adopts new capabilities. Regular updates often add requested features, fix issues, and improve model performance without user intervention. Track release notes to gauge ongoing development momentum.

7. SurferSEO
SurferSEO combines content editor scoring with AI text generation inside the same workspace. This setup lets writers see scores update as they edit each section.
Content score factors include keyword placement, heading structure, and word count alignment. Users can adjust their draft to match the top ranking pages for their topic. The platform helps writers target a balanced reading level and sentence length.
Keyword density targets appear as guidelines rather than strict rules. Writers can check how often terms appear across headings, paragraphs, and image alt text. This approach supports natural language while staying close to search expectations.
The AI paragraph rewrite feature offers fresh phrasing suggestions for existing sections. Writers can accept, reject, or further edit these options directly in the editor. This keeps the workflow smooth without switching between separate tools.
Many content teams use SurferSEO alongside other AI writing software when they need SEO guidance during drafting. The platform works well for long form articles where ranking potential matters most.

How to Choose the Right Option
Match tool capabilities to site goals, traffic volume, and team size before committing credits or subscriptions.
Bloggers first need to calculate how many articles their site requires each month. This number sets the baseline for any credit system or subscription tier.
SEO professionals should map every required language and every integration their workflow depends on. Missing either requirement wastes time later.
Marketing agencies must review credit rollover policies and support availability before signing up multiple clients. These two factors directly affect project deadlines and cash flow.
Start the decision process by listing exact monthly article volume. Bloggers often need 10 to 30 posts while agencies may require 100 or more.
